加入收藏 | 设为首页 | 会员中心 | 我要投稿 站长网 (https://www.shaguniang.cn/)- 数据快递、应用安全、业务安全、智能内容、文字识别!
当前位置: 首页 > 综合聚焦 > 编程要点 > 资讯 > 正文

VR开发实战:资讯整合、编译提速与性能优化一站式指南

发布时间:2026-05-13 06:47:22 所属栏目:资讯 来源:DaWei
导读:  在虚拟现实(VR)开发中,高效整合资讯、快速编译与持续性能优化是项目成功的关键。开发者常面临信息过载、构建时间长、运行卡顿等问题。解决这些问题,需要一套系统化的方法论,贯穿从前期调研到最终发布的全流

  在虚拟现实(VR)开发中,高效整合资讯、快速编译与持续性能优化是项目成功的关键。开发者常面临信息过载、构建时间长、运行卡顿等问题。解决这些问题,需要一套系统化的方法论,贯穿从前期调研到最终发布的全流程。


  资讯整合的核心在于建立专属的知识管理框架。面对海量的技术文档、社区讨论和官方更新,建议使用工具如Notion或Obsidian搭建个人知识库。将引擎版本说明、兼容性列表、常见错误代码归类整理,并标注来源与时间戳。定期回顾并更新内容,避免依赖过时资料。同时关注GitHub上的活跃项目与Unity/Unreal Engine的官方博客,能第一时间获取关键更新。


  编译提速直接影响开发效率。一个动辄几分钟的构建过程会严重打断创作节奏。可通过启用增量编译、关闭不必要的插件、精简资源包来降低负担。在Unity中,使用Scripting Define Symbols控制条件编译,在Unreal中合理配置模块依赖。将大型场景拆分为多个子场景,采用LOD(细节层次)加载策略,可显著减少单次编译的规模。


  性能优化需贯穿整个开发周期。初期即应设定帧率目标(如90fps或120fps),并使用内置分析工具监控每帧耗时。重点关注渲染开销:减少多边形数量、合并静态网格、合理使用Shader变体。避免在每一帧执行复杂计算,如物理模拟或脚本逻辑,优先使用对象池和事件驱动机制。对音频与粒子系统也要严格控制实例数量,防止内存溢出。


  测试阶段必须覆盖不同设备型号与用户场景。利用真机调试替代仅依赖模拟器,尤其关注头戴设备的视差误差与晕动症表现。通过日志记录关键节点状态,如加载时间、内存峰值、输入延迟,形成性能基线。结合自动化测试脚本,定期回归验证核心功能稳定性。


  团队协作中的流程标准化同样重要。制定统一的资源命名规范、版本控制策略与提交模板,确保每位成员都能快速理解项目结构。使用CI/CD管道实现自动构建与部署,减少人为失误。定期组织代码评审与性能复盘,让经验沉淀为团队资产。


  VR开发不仅是技术实现,更是一场对效率与体验的双重挑战。掌握资讯整合、编译优化与性能调优的协同方法,能让开发过程更流畅,产品更稳定。真正优秀的VR应用,不仅视觉震撼,更能在每一个交互瞬间展现出流畅与精准。

(编辑:站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章